Who We Are
Safe Harbor Child Advocacy Center is a small, thriving non-profit that enjoys robust support
from community members and funders. We work closely with a multi-disciplinary team
to serve and advocate for children and teenagers that have experienced sexual abuse,
physical abuse, trafficking, neglect, and/or have witnessed domestic violence and other
violent crimes. We also support their non-offending caregivers, which is essential to the
child’s healing and recovery. Safe Harbor is a trauma-informed space that values the
diversity of our clients and staff. We recognize the occupational hazards of secondary
trauma and empathic strain that can result from working with traumatic material. Thus
Safe Harbor is committed to offering a high quality work environment with flexible hours,
professional trust and autonomy, supportive co-workers, a wellness stipend, health
insurance at prorated levels, and generous paid leave.
